Stephenie Dawn's New Book 'The Real Life Fiction Diary' is an Engaging Story About an Ordinary Single Mom With a Shocking Secret, and a Very Complicated Life

Stephenie Dawn, a delightfully gifted and creative writer, has completed her most recent book “The Real Life Fiction Diary”:  a fabulous and engaging story of Anne Vernon. Anne is an ordinary woman, a single mom with a difficult life, three friends, an angry school, a surprise too outrageous to mention, aliens since five, and something else she and no one else ever expected.

Stephenie muses, “Isn’t funny when asked to write about other people, a train full of eloquent words spill forth with precision, however, when referring to oneself, a semicomatic freeze comes over the brain and any complimentary attributes have become lost in the sands of time.”

Stephanie describes herself as a little crazy but a happy writer who has dedicated this story to her late father and for the world to become a better place.

Published by Fulton Books, Stephenie Dawn's book follows the thoughts and daily life of Anne Vernon, single mother. Annie has a life full of complications, the least of which is being repeatedly abducted by aliens since the age of five.  

The book is written as a multi-layered diary with twists and turns and interesting scenarios throughout.
